Infrastructure

레지스트리 Run* 실행 막기

duraboys 2010. 3. 19. 09:59
레지스트리의 시작프로그램 목록이 있는 Run 키를 사용하지 못하게 하는 방법입니다. 이것은 양날의 검과 같아서, 활용하기에 따라서 자동으로 등록되어 버리는 악성 코드의 실행을 막을 수도 있지만 다른 한편으로는 꼭 필요한 프로그램의 사용을 차단할 수도 있으니 신중하게 사용하시길 바랍니다.


레지스트리 편집기를 실행하여
H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ersion
policiesExplorer을 찾습니다.

DWORD값으로 아래의 4가지 명령어중 필요한것을 만들고, 값을 1로 설정합니다.

1.DisableLocalMachineRun
(H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ows
CurrentVersionRun 사용불가)

2.DisableLocalMachineRunOnce
(H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indows
CurrentVersionRunOnce 사용불가)

3.DisableCurrentUserRun
(HKEY_CURRENT_USERSOFTWAREMicrosoftWindows
CurrentVersionRun 사용불가)

4.DisableCurrentUserRunOnce
(HKEY_CURRENT_USERSOFTWAREMicrosoftWindows
CurrentVersionRunOnce 사용불가)

위와 같이 입력하면 해당 키에 프로그램 목록이 등록되어있어도
실제로는 구동하지 않게 됩니다.


원본출처 : pcbangas.com